Asteron Life awarded for tool
Suncorp-owned Asteron Life has received a global market award for its so-called Wheel of Balance tool.
The company announced this week the tool had won the ‘Best Use of Content Curation' category of the global Content Marketing Institute Awards.
The company described the Wheel of Balance as beings an interactive tool housed on Asteron Life's customer-facing Balance Blog content platform.
It said the tool was an engaging, useful, and fun mechanism that let users undertake a personalised self-assessment of each area of their lives (finance, family and friends, career, health etc.) and, depending on their results, then provided users with valuable content from Asteron Life's health and wellbeing blog platform, Balance, which had a network of experts uniquely tailored to their specific needs.
Suncorp head of brand and marketing, Tammy Hall, said the aim of Wheel of Balance was to reinvigorate engagement with the blog and use its results to inform ongoing content generation.
